Default ES250 advice and opinions

I will be getting a chance to pick up a 1990 ES250. I helped a friend locate a replacement car for her mom, and she said she would give me first dibs on the Lexus.

She is the 2nd owner and it has 80,000 miles. Everything works and I believe it has a pretty good service history. I have not seen the car in person, but knowing this family I bet it is very clean. I believe its white. Not sure what year they bought it, but they have had it for a long time.

Since there were not many of the ES250s built, there is not alot of information out there. However, I have been told that this engine is bullet proof. Is that correct, is this a good motor? I know this is a 20 yr. old car, and things will break and wear items will need to be replaced. Also, considering the car is in good shape and maintained, what is it worth? She did mention that her mother took it to the dealership for an oil leak and they charged her 3k. She said it still leaks a little oil.

Any comments or advice appreciated.

I have never met a Toyota that did not leak oil. Old cars will leak oil, its a fact of life. Get one leak, you need to replace all the seals...otherwise it will find a new hole. Trust me.

The es250 is basicly a Camry v6 dressed up for prom. The Es250 is an awsome car, you will need to change the timing belt, water pump and oil pump. I hear the bearings on these motors can be really touchy...but other than that you can expect 200k + out of this car.

I would jump at the chance to get my hands on a 80k ES250.

And to boot, my 91 Es250 on bad tires and a jacked up alignment drives better than my 2006 Altima SE. Get the Lexus.
